Mellifluous. Katus's songs tell of her travels through the world, drawing strongly on her east european and celtic roots. Love, passion,murder,protest and silliness.Her unique self taught african style guitar playing and stunning sax of Tony Wrafter-Pop G

"A linguistic whiz, Katus performs in English, Czech, French,Russian and Bulgarian..the resulting accopella numbers stand out in Young's performance, revealing the breadth and depth of her talent. When the instruments are stripped away, her voice fills the room, rising and falling like an exotic bird." kristen D'Agostino, Prague Post
